Megane Renaultsport 265 Trophy and the Nurburgring crew First we get the news that Renault has pushed out a limited edition Megane Renaulsport – the Megane Renaulsport 265 Trophy with a slightly tweaked and titivated version of the Megane Renaultsport 250 – and now we get the follow-up publicity with the claim of a new Nurburgring record for the brisk Megane. This isn’t a record that’s quite as daft as some of the records that are claimed for the Nurburgring (there almost seems to be a specific category of ‘Record’ time to fit every car maker’s needs), but it does seem a bit obscure. It’s the Nurburgring record for the fastest production front wheel drive car.

Another follow up from an earlier teaser shot is this, the 2012 Subaru Impreza, which is making its debut at the NY auto show. Digressing further from its infamous rally-bred history, the latest Impreza is being billed as the most economical AWD car for sale in the US market, and Subaru is also keen to stress the increased ride comfort and interior space of this model, which is claimed to offer unprecedented levels of refinement from an Impreza. The cars exterior, however, does have some nostalgic references, with the bold arches said to 'emphasize its sporty roots and standard All-Wheel Drive performance'.
